The Weekly Notable Startup Funding Report: 8/31/26

AlleyWatch by AlleyWatch
The Weekly Notable Startup Funding Report: 8/31/26
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

The Weekly Notable Startup Funding Report takes us on a trip across various ecosystems in the US, highlighting some of the notable funding activity in the various markets that we track. The notable startup funding rounds for the week ending 8/29/26 featuring funding details for Liner, CivilGrid, Transfyr, and thirty-two other deals representing $2.0B in new funding that you need to know about.



Arga Labs – $10.0M

San Francisco-based Arga Labs develops software testing and validation infrastructure for AI agents and applications. Founded by Akira Tong and Phillip Li in 2025, Arga Labs has now raised a total of $10.5M in total equity funding and is backed by BoxGroup, Emergence, General Catalyst, Gradient, Spot VC, and SV Angel.


Blank Street – $75.0M

Brooklyn-based Blank Street is a coffee chain that offers coffee as a daily ritual that more people can enjoy, in places convenient to their lives. Founded by Issam Freiha and Vinay Menda in 2020, Blank Street has now raised a total of $224.7M in total equity funding and is backed by General Atlantic, General Catalyst, Left Lane Capital, and Tiger Global Management.


Breedr – $27.0M

Austin-based Breedr is a cattle management platform that tracks individual animals from conception through processing. Founded by Ian Wheal in 2018, Breedr has now raised a total of $44.2M in total equity funding and is backed by Latitude, Outsiders Fund, and Partech.


Celera Semiconductor – $30.0M

Santa Clara-based Celera Semiconductor is an innovative startup leveraging AI and software automation to transform the analog semiconductor industry. Founded by Calum MacRae in 2018, Celera Semiconductor has now raised a total of $50M in total equity funding and is backed by Maverick Silicon.


CivilGrid – $26.0M

San Francisco-based CivilGrid provides a pre-construction data platform for engineering and construction teams. Founded by Brandon Cohen and Josh Mackanic in 2020, CivilGrid has now raised a total of $28.2M in total equity funding and is backed by A*, Afore Capital, Energy Impact Partners, Ford Street Ventures, SNR, and Spark Capital.

Cloverleaf AI – $8.0M

Denver-based Cloverleaf AI is a SaaS solution that provides vendors with early insights into RFPs through analysis of government meetings. Founded by Adam Zucker, Jeremy Becker, and Taylor McLemore in 2021, Cloverleaf AI has now raised a total of $10.9M in total equity funding and is backed by Ivy Ventures, Jackson Square Ventures, S3 Ventures, and Tawani Ventures.


Corvus Robotics – $20.0M

Mountain View-based Corvus Robotics builds autonomous inventory drones for real-time visibility in the world’s largest warehouses. Founded by Jackie Wu and Mohammed Kabir in 2017, Corvus Robotics has now raised a total of $38M in total equity funding and is backed by Catalyst Investors, Cibus Fund, f7 Ventures, S2G Investments, and Spero Ventures.


Digs – $25.3M

Vancouver-based Digs is an AI-powered construction software company that helps homebuilders manage projects, documents, and homeowner communication. Founded by Ryan Fink and Ty Frackiewicz in 2022, Digs has now raised a total of $44.3M in total equity funding and is backed by Builders FirstSource.


Emerald AI – $150.0M

Washington-based Emerald AI develops software that aligns AI data center workloads with real-time power grid conditions to manage energy use. Founded by Varun Sivaram in 2024, Emerald AI has now raised a total of $216.5M in total equity funding and is backed by ADVentures, Aramco Ventures, Aventurine Partners, Collective Global Management, DCVC, Earthshot Ventures, Emerson Collective, Energize Capital, Energy Impact Partners, General Catalyst, GE Vernova, IQT, Jeff Dean, JERA Ventures, John Doerr, John Kerry, Lowercarbon Capital, Marunouchi Innovation Partners, NVIDIA, Radical Ventures, RWE, Sabanci Climate Ventures, Salesforce Ventures, Samsung Ventures, Siemens, Temerty Group, The Olayan Group, and Tom Steyer’s.


Faro AI – $37.3M

La Jolla-based Faro Health develops software to assists clinical development processes, including workflow automation and clinical trial design. Founded by Ross A. Jaffe and Scott Chetham in 2019, Faro AI has now raised a total of $72.3M in total equity funding and is backed by Ankona Capital, General Catalyst, Merck Global Health Innovation Fund, Northpond Ventures, Polaris Partners, PTX Capital, S32, and Zetta Venture Partners.



Gatik – $200.0M

Santa Clara-based Gatik develops autonomous trucking technology and provides driverless middle-mile logistics services for businesses. Founded by Apeksha Kumavat, Arjun Narang, and Gautam Narang in 2017, Gatik has now raised a total of $504.7M in total equity funding and is backed by Alumni Ventures, ARK Investment Management, Intact Private Capital, Koch Disruptive Technologies, Millennium Management, and Qatar Investment Authority.


Generalist AI – $200.0M

San Mateo-based Generalist AI develops AI and robotics technologies focused on enabling robots to perform physical tasks in real-world environments. Founded by Andrew Barry, Andy Zeng, and Pete Florence in 2024, Generalist AI has now raised a total of $753M in total equity funding and is backed by 8VC, Bezos Expeditions, Fei-Fei Li, Hanabi Capital, NVIDIA, Radical Ventures, Spark Capital, and Union Square Ventures.


Hike Medical – $22.5M

San Francisco-based Hike Medical develops a healthcare technology platform that supports the workflow for medical devices and providers. Founded by Aadi Bhanti, Amit Bhanti, and Steven Chacko in 2022, Hike Medical has now raised a total of $27.5M in total equity funding and is backed by Fifth Down Capital, Indicator Ventures, Jerod Mayo, Orthofeet, RiverPark Ventures, Saga Ventures, and Sam Blond.


Hivemind Capital Partners – $17.0M

New York-based Hivemind Capital Partners is a blockchain-focused investment business. Founded by Matt Zhang in 2021, Hivemind Capital Partners has now raised a total of $27M in total equity funding and is backed by China Pacific Insurance, FalconX, M&G Investments, Sonic Boom Ventures, and ZA Bank.


Instinct – $250.0M

San Francisco-based Instinct is an artificial intelligence startup developing AI technology. Founded by Noah Shinn in 2025, Instinct has now raised a total of $325M in total equity funding and is backed by Benchmark and Index Ventures.



Keenable – $26.0M

San Francisco-based Keenable.ai is a independent web search infrastructure provider built specifically for AI labs and autonomous agents. Founded by Andrey Styskin and Matthias Petri in 2025, Keenable has now raised a total of $26M in total equity funding and is backed by Accel, Brightwing Capital, Conviction, and ScOp Venture Capital.


Levanta – $22.0M

Seattle-based Levanta is a creator affiliate and commerce platform that helps e-commerce brands manage partnerships across marketplaces. Founded by Ian Brodie, Rob Schab, and Spencer McKenney in 2022, Levanta has now raised a total of $43.4M in total equity funding and is backed by Volition Capital.


Light Links, Inc. – $6.0M

Berkeley-based Wireless Communication, Free Space Optics,. Founded by Firouz Vafadari, Tyler Morton, and Wayne Fenton in 2024, Light Links, Inc. has now raised a total of $6M in total equity funding and is backed by Anorak Ventures, Crosscourt Ventures, Mana Ventures, Outlander VC, Output Capital, and Santa Cruz Ventures.


Liner – $36.1M

San Francisco-based Liner develops AI agents and tools that support search, research, writing, and information analysis for professional and academic workflows. Founded by Chanmin Woo and Jinu Kim in 2015, Liner has now raised a total of $79.8M in total equity funding and is backed by Atinum Partners, CJ Investment, Daishin Securities, Helios Private Equity, InterVest, KB Securities, Korea Development Bank, LB Investment, and STIC Ventures.


Mara – $7.0M

San Francisco-based Mara develops autonomous counter-drone systems designed to detect, track, and defeat radio-silent FPV drones. Founded by Daniel Kofman and Sriram Raghu in 2024, Mara has now raised a total of $7.8M in total equity funding and is backed by a16z speedrun, Freedom Fund VC, Indicator Fund, Khosla Ventures, Night Capital, Palm Drive Capital, and Protagonist.



Metriport – $26.0M

San Francisco-based Metriport is a healthcare data infrastructure company that provides tools for accessing, integrating, and analyzing patient records. Founded by Colin Elsinga and Dima Goncharov in 2022, Metriport has now raised a total of $28.4M in total equity funding and is backed by Artis Ventures, Matrix, and Y Combinator.


Mundo AI – $20.0M

San Francisco-based Mundo AI develops data, evaluations, and applied research for frontier AI labs and companies. Founded by Garreth Lee, Jason Liao, Kenneth Wu, and Naijide Anwaer in 2024, Mundo AI has now raised a total of $24M in total equity funding and is backed by E12 Ventures, GreatPoint Ventures, NEXT Frontier Capital, and Y Combinator.


Onos Health – $17.0M

San Francisco-based Onos Health provides an AI platform that analyzes unstructured behavioral health documentation and converts it into clinical intelligence. Founded by Akshay Agarwal, Josh Levitan, and Suhaas Prasad in 2024, Onos Health has now raised a total of $23.3M in total equity funding and is backed by Costanoa Ventures, CVS Health Ventures, and Flare Capital Partners.


Owner – $240.0M

Palo Alto-based Owner is a technology company that provides tools for local restaurant owners to enhance sales and online presence. Founded by Adam Guild and Dean Bloembergen in 2018, Owner has now raised a total of $422.2M in total equity funding and is backed by Goldman Sachs Asset Management, Headline, Jack Altman, Meritech Capital Partners, and Redpoint.


Quintessent – $40.0M

Goleta-based Quintessent is a Santa Barbara start-up that commercializes quantum dot-based lasers and photonic integrated circuits. Founded by Alan Liu in 2019, Quintessent has now raised a total of $52.7M in total equity funding and is backed by Ciena, Cycle Capital, Foothill Ventures, Hina Liberty Capital, Industry Ventures, InterVest Co., M Ventures, OUP (Osage University Partners), Safar Partners, Sierra Ventures, and Susquehanna International Group.

Shape Memory Medical – $10.0M

Santa Clara-based Shape Memory Medical is a medical device company that develops innovative medical devices based on Shape Memory Polymer (SMP) materials. Founded by Duncan Maitland and Saurabh Biswas in 2009, Shape Memory Medical has now raised a total of $64M in total equity funding and is backed by August Global Partners, Earlybird Venture Capital, HBM Healthcare Investments, Heal Venture Lab, Taiwania Capital Management Corporation, and Wexford Capital.


SiFly – $20.0M

Santa Clara-based SiFly delivers advanced drones with helicopter-level capabilities, patented hardware, AI, and cloud connectivity. Founded by Brian L. Hinman in 2021, SiFly has now raised a total of $20M in total equity funding and is backed by Alumni Ventures, BBK Capital, Qudit Investments, and Shield Capital.


Socure – $156.0M

Incline Village-based Socure provides digital identity verification, fraud prevention, and regulatory compliance software through an AI-driven platform. Founded by Bradley S. Leinhardt, Johnny Ayers, and Sunil Madhu in 2012, Socure has now raised a total of $802.9M in total equity funding and is backed by Docusign, Goldman Sachs Alternatives, Summit Partners, and Wells Fargo.


Stability AI – $76.0M

Los Angeles-based Stability AI develops generative AI models and tools for creating and editing visual, audio, video, and three-dimensional content. Founded by Cyrus Hodes and Emad Mostaque in 2019, Stability AI has now raised a total of $257M in total equity funding and is backed by AMD Ventures, Coatue, Electronic Arts, Eric Schmidt, Greycroft, Kadmos Capital, MANTIS Venture Capital, Pacific Alliance Ventures, Sean Parker, Sony Music Entertainment, Sound Ventures, Universal Music Group, and Warner Music Group.


Standard Metrics – $21.3M

San Francisco-based Standard Metrics provides a portfolio management platform for venture capital and private equity firms and their portfolio companies. Founded by Deny Khoung, John Melas-Kyriazi, and Kevin Hsu in 2020, Standard Metrics has now raised a total of $51M in total equity funding and is backed by 8VC, Calm Ventures, First Trust Capital Partners, Gaingels, January Capital, Kindergarten Ventures, Salesforce Ventures, Socii Capital, and Spark Capital.


TerraBlaster – $12.5M

Redwood City-based TerraBlaster is a cutting-edge agricultural technology firm focused on transforming sustainable agriculture through enhanced automation. Founded by Jorge Heraud in 2024, TerraBlaster has now raised a total of $16.5M in total equity funding and is backed by Ag Startup Engine, Artesian VC, Bidra Innovation Ventures, Builders Vision, GrainInnovate, Khosla Ventures, Plug and Play, Reservoir, Sunna Ventures, Trailhead Capital, and Ulu Ventures.


Transfyr – $25.0M

Boston-based Transfyr builds AI tools that help transfer scientific research into real-world applications and innovation. Founded by Anna Marie Wagner in 2025, Transfyr has now raised a total of $25M in total equity funding and is backed by Breakout Ventures, Factory Capital, General Catalyst, Lux Capital, Lyda Hill Philanthropies, MVP Ventures, Neo, SV Angel, and Underscore VC.


Voya Energy – $35.0M

Hayward-based Voya Energy develops metal-fueled energy systems that generate electricity using recycled aluminum and compact power-generation equipment. Founded by Matt Horton, Richard Wang, and Steven Kaye in 2025, Voya Energy has now raised a total of $48M in total equity funding and is backed by Energy Impact Partners, Founders Fund, John Doerr, MANTIS Venture Capital, Overmatch Ventures, Seven Stars, and StepStone Group.


Yardstik – $30.0M

Minneapolis-based Yardstik provides workforce screening and risk management services for businesses and technology platforms. Founded by Jeff Hinck, Justin Kaufenberg, and Matt Meents in 2019, Yardstik has now raised a total of $54M in total equity funding and is backed by Crosslink Capital, Great North Ventures, Grotech Ventures, Harbert Growth Partners, MissionOG, and Rally Ventures.
